1 Kings 18:31-35 International Children’s Bible (ICB)

31. He took 12 stones. He took 1 stone for each of the 12 tribes. These 12 tribes were named for the 12 sons of Jacob. (Jacob was the man the Lord had called Israel.)

32. Elijah used these stones to rebuild the altar in honor of the Lord. Then he dug a small ditch around it. It was big enough to hold about 13 quarts of seed.

33. Elijah put the wood on the altar. He cut the bull into pieces and laid them on the wood. Then he said, “Fill four jars with water. Put the water on the meat and on the wood.”

34. Then Elijah said, “Do it again.” And they did it again.Then he said, “Do it a third time.” And they did it the third time.

35. So the water ran off of the altar and filled the ditch.
